注册表的一些基础和注册表禁用30项
windows 9x注册表逻辑结构中包含六个根键,每个根键包含着分类不同的信息!在windowsNT/2000/XP中,如果用windows自带的编辑器打开的时候,只能看到五个,还有一个隐藏的根键:HKEY_PERFOR_MANCE_DATA.
*HKEY_CLASS_ROOT
记录windows操作系统中所有数据文件的格式和关联信息,主要记录不同文件的文件名后缀和与之对应的应用程序其下子键可分为两类:一类是已经注册的各类文件的扩展名,这类子键前面都带有一个".";另一类是各类文件类型有关信息.
*HKEY_CURRENT_USER
些根根键包含当前登录用户的用户配置文件信息,这些信息保证不同的用户登录计算机时,使用自己的修改化设置,例如自己定义的墙纸,自己的收件箱,自己的安全访问权限.
*HKEY_LOCAL_MACHINE
此根键包含了当前计算机的配置灵气,包括所安装的硬件以软件设置.这些信息是为所有的用户登录系统服务的.这是事个注册表中最庞大也是最重要的根键!
*HKEY_USERS
HKEY_USERS根键包括默认用户的信息(DEFAULT子键)和所有以前登陆用户的信息.
*HKEY_CURRENT_CONFIG
此根键实际上是HKDY_LOCAL_MACHINE/CONFIG/0001分支下的数据完全一样.
*HKEY_DYN_DATA根键
这个键保存每次系统启动时,创建的系统配置和当前性能信息.这个根键只存在于windows 9X中
*HKEY_PERFORMANCE_DATA
在windowsNT/2000/XP注册表中虽然没有HKEY_DYN_DAT键,但是它却隐藏了一个名为"HKEY_PERFORMANCE_DATA的键.所有系统中的动态信息都是存放在此子键中,系统自带的注册表编辑器无法看到些键.介可以用专门的程序来查看此键,比如使用性能监视器.
首先开始运行输入regedit或regedt32
然后在注册表的“H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\Explorer”子键下通过建立新的项及设置不同的键值可以禁用“我的电脑”中的驱动器,禁用“查找”、“运行”等功能,其实在这个子键下还可以通过新建其它一些键值来禁用更多的功能,下面将部分禁用的项目简介如下,供有兴趣的朋友参考。
1.新建二进制键值NoDriveTypeAutoRun,设置键值为b5,00,00,00,禁用光盘自动运行;
2.新建dword键值EditLevel,设置键值为1,禁用开始菜单中“程序”上的水平线;
3.新建二进制键值NoStartBanner,设置键值为01,00,00,00,禁用单击“从这里开始”动画箭头;
4.新建dword键值NoFavoritesMenu,设置键值为1,禁用开始菜单中的“收藏夹”;
5.新建dword键值NoRecentDocsMenu,设置键值为1,禁用开始菜单中的“文档”;
6.新建dword键值Nofind,设置键值为1,禁用开始菜单中的“查找”;
7.新建dword键值NoRun,设置键值为1,禁用开始菜单中的“运行”;
8.新建dword键值NoLogOff,设置键值为1,禁用开始菜单中的“注销”;
9.新建dword键值NoClose,设置键值为1,禁用开始菜单中的“关闭”;
10.新建二进制键值NoRecentDocsHistory,设置键值为01,00,00,00,不保存新近打开的文档历史记录;
11.新建二进制键值ClearRecentDocsonExit,设置键值为01,00,00,00,退出时自动删除“运行”、“查找”中的历史记录,与第10项一起设置,自动清除新近打开的所有文档的历史记录;
12.新建dword键值NoNetHood,设置键值为1,禁用“网上邻居”图标;
13.新建dword键值NoInternetIcon,设置键值为1,禁用IE浏览器图标;
14.新建dword键值NoSaveSettings,设置键值为1,禁用退出时保存设置(锁定桌面);
15.新建二进制键值NoDrives,键值设置为01,00,00,00禁用A驱动器,设置为ffffffff禁用所有驱动器;
16.新建dword键值NoFileMenu,设置键值为1,禁用“我的电脑”、“资源管理器”及“我的文档”中的“文件”菜单;
17.新建dword键值NoActiveDesktop,设置键值为1,禁用显示属性中的“Web”选项卡;
18.新建dword键值NoChangeStartMenu,设置键值为1,禁用在开始菜单中拖放快捷菜单;
19.新建dword键值NoViewContextMenu,设置键值为1,禁用右键快捷菜单;
20.新建dword键值NoTrayContextMenu,设置键值为1,禁用任务栏的快捷菜单;
21.新建dword键值NoDesktop,设置键值为1,禁用桌面上的所有图标选项;
22.新建dword键值NoAddPrinter,设置键值为1,在打印机文件夹中禁用“添加打印机”;
23.新建dword键值NoDeletePrinter,设置键值为1,在打印机文件夹中禁用“删除打印机”;
24.新建dword键值NoPrinterTabs,设置键值为1,禁用打印机属性中的“常规”和“详细”选项卡;
25.新建dword键值NoSetFolders,设置键值为1,禁用“设置”中的“控制面板”和“打印机”
26.新建dword键值NoSetTaskbar,设置键值为1,禁用“设置”中的“任务栏属性和开始菜单”;
27.新建dword键值NofolderOptions,设置键值为1,禁用“设置”菜单中的“文件夹选项”;
28.新建dword键值NoSetActiveDesktop,设置键值为1,禁用“设置”菜单中的“活动桌面”;
29.新建dword键值NoWindowsUpdate,设置键值为1,禁用“设置”菜单中的“WindowsUpdate”选项;
30.上述第25、26、27、28、29五项全部禁用后则可以在开始菜单中删除“设置”选项。